CRAFT is a reader-supported email newsletter about the nuts and bolts of fiction writing and the world of publishing.

I read two profiles this week that got me thinking. The first was this Vanity Fair piece about Cormac McCarthy’s “muse”—Augusta Britt, a 16-year-old girl he met at a motel pool when he was 42. Said girl was bouncing between foster homes, …
